    Did you know XP's Genuine Advantage Tool regularly phones home to Microsoft?

    I came across this by accident because a couple of progs that normally start on boot (such as ICQ) hung for some reason, and a dialog popped up saying that the Genuine Advantage Tool wasn't responding. Hmmm. Why would GAT be running at boot?

    Did a quick web search and what do you know... it runs because it's trying to phone home. Daily.

    I bet that's one thing that the SP2 firewall doesn't block!!!
